Today, many novice investors tend to focus exclusively on investment returns with little concern for PTS's investment risk. Other traders do consider volatility but use just one or two very conventional indicators such as PTS's standard deviation. In reality, there are many statistical measures that can use PTS historical prices to predict the future PTS's volatility.Sophisticated investors, who have witnessed many market ups and downs, anticipate that the market will even out over time. This tendency of PTS's price to converge to an average value over time is called mean reversion. However, historically, high market prices usually discourage investors that believe in mean reversion to invest, while low prices are viewed as an opportunity to buy.

The output start index for this execution was fifty with a total number of output elements of eleven. The Average True Range was developed by J. Welles Wilder in 1970s. It is one of components of the Welles Wilder Directional Movement indicators. The ATR is a measure of PTS Inc volatility. High ATR values indicate high volatility, and low values indicate low volatility.
